COLUMBUS, OH, January 14, 2024 - Planet TV Studios, a major creator of innovative tv series, happily announces its latest documentary series, "New Frontiers," featuring the pioneering work of Andelyn Biosciences. This documentary will investigate the new advances produced by Andelyn Biosciences, a prominent gene therapy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), in the vital landscape of biotechnology. "New Frontiers" is a provocative series mindfully crafted to delve into revolutionary agencies that happen to be at the forefront of molding the future of healthcare internationally. The documentary episodes will be airing early 2024 on national television, Bloomberg TV, and accessible on on-demand through various platforms, including Amazon, Google Play, Roku, and more.

Planet TV Studios is excited to have Gina Grad back as their host. Gina is an accomplished author, podcast host, and radio personality primarily based in Los Angeles, California. She formerly served as the co-host and news anchor of the Adam Carolla Show, a podcast that held the Guinness World Record for the most downloaded episodes. Gina in addition has anchored on KFI 640 AM and hosted mornings on 100.3 FM. Additionally her broadcasting career, she is the author of "My Extra Mom," a children's book created to help kids and stepparents in navigating the challenges of blended families.

Through the complicated industry of biotechnology, Andelyn Biosciences has surfaced as a visionary, developing advanced therapies and adding considerably to the biopharmaceutical business. Formed in 2020, the firm, headquartered in Columbus, Ohio, originated out of Nationwide Children's Hospital's Abigail Wexner Research Institute with a mission to speeding up the emergence and manufacturing of innovative therapies to bring more treatments to more patients.

Genetic Carriers

Pathogens have adapted to effectively transport nucleic acids into recipient cells, making them an effective tool for DNA-based treatment. Widely used viral vectors feature:

Adenoviruses – Able to penetrate both dividing and static cells but often trigger host defenses.

Adeno-Associated Viruses (AAVs) – Favorable due to their lower immunogenicity and potential to ensure extended gene expression.

Retroviruses and Lentiviruses – Incorporate into the cellular DNA, offering sustained transcription, with lentiviral vectors being particularly beneficial for altering dormant cellular structures.

Synthetic Gene Transport Mechanisms

Synthetic genetic modification approaches present a less immunogenic choice, reducing the risk of immune reactions. These include:

Liposomes and Nanoparticles – Packaging DNA or RNA for targeted internalization.

Electrical Permeabilization – Using electrical pulses to create temporary pores in biological enclosures, permitting nucleic acid infiltration.

Targeted Genetic Infusion – Administering DNA sequences straight into localized cells.

Genetic Engineering Solutions: Restructuring the Genetic Blueprint

Gene therapy achieves results by repairing the underlying problem of genetic diseases:

In-Body Gene Treatment: Introduces genetic instructions straight into the patient’s body, for example the FDA-approved Spark Therapeutics’ Luxturna for treating hereditary ocular disorders.

External Genetic Modification: Consists of editing a patient’s cells in a lab and then returning them, as seen in some research-based therapies for hereditary blood ailments and immunodeficiencies.

The advent of genetic scissors CRISPR-Cas9 has dramatically improved gene therapy studies, enabling fine-tuned edits at the DNA level.
